    Default Trying to start a band

    I got approached a couple weeks ago about starting a band with someone I had jammed with. He's a guitarist as well and president of a local blues society. He said he really liked my playing. We started talking and found we had a lot of similar tastes in blues, so we're now trying to get some players together and get something going. I guess our genre would be Geezer Blues.

    It's exciting. I haven't posted about it due to not wanting to jinx it, but hey. Seems like we're lining up some people who want to do it: drummer, harp, maybe a bassist. I'm beyond flattered, since I really just started playing out a couple years ago and have never considered myself any great shakes. However, I do love playing the blues live. The other guitarist and I have played out together at several jams, and the sound and the chemistry are pretty good so far.

    I'll keep everybody posted!
